mirror of
https://codeberg.org/nobody/LocalCDN.git
synced 2025-06-05 21:49:31 +02:00
Added JavaScript Cookie v2.2.1
This commit is contained in:
@ -95,6 +95,9 @@ var files = {
|
|||||||
// jQuery jeditable
|
// jQuery jeditable
|
||||||
'resources/jquery-jeditable/1.8.0/jquery.jeditable.min.jsm': true,
|
'resources/jquery-jeditable/1.8.0/jquery.jeditable.min.jsm': true,
|
||||||
|
|
||||||
|
// JavaScript Cookie
|
||||||
|
'resources/js-cookie/2.2.1/js.cookie.min.jsm': true,
|
||||||
|
|
||||||
// lazysizes
|
// lazysizes
|
||||||
'resources/lazysizes/4.1.8/lazysizes.min.jsm': true,
|
'resources/lazysizes/4.1.8/lazysizes.min.jsm': true,
|
||||||
|
|
||||||
|
@ -84,6 +84,7 @@ var mappings = {
|
|||||||
'jqueryui/{version}/jquery-ui.js': resources.jQueryUI,
|
'jqueryui/{version}/jquery-ui.js': resources.jQueryUI,
|
||||||
'jqueryui/{version}/jquery-ui.min.js': resources.jQueryUI,
|
'jqueryui/{version}/jquery-ui.min.js': resources.jQueryUI,
|
||||||
'jquery-validate/{version}/jquery.validate.min.js': resources.jqueryValidationPlugin,
|
'jquery-validate/{version}/jquery.validate.min.js': resources.jqueryValidationPlugin,
|
||||||
|
'js-cookie/{version}/js.cookie.min.js': resources.jscookie,
|
||||||
'lazysizes/{version}/lazysizes.min.js': resources.lazysizes,
|
'lazysizes/{version}/lazysizes.min.js': resources.lazysizes,
|
||||||
'modernizr/{version}/modernizr.': resources.modernizr,
|
'modernizr/{version}/modernizr.': resources.modernizr,
|
||||||
'moment.js/{version}/moment.': resources.moment,
|
'moment.js/{version}/moment.': resources.moment,
|
||||||
|
@ -124,6 +124,11 @@ var resources = {
|
|||||||
'path': 'resources/jquery-validate/{version}/jquery.validate.min.jsm',
|
'path': 'resources/jquery-validate/{version}/jquery.validate.min.jsm',
|
||||||
'type': 'application/javascript'
|
'type': 'application/javascript'
|
||||||
},
|
},
|
||||||
|
// resources/js-cookie/2.2.1/js.cookie.min.jsm
|
||||||
|
'jscookie': {
|
||||||
|
'path': 'resources/js-cookie/{version}/js.cookie.min.jsm',
|
||||||
|
'type': 'application/javascript'
|
||||||
|
},
|
||||||
// lazysizes
|
// lazysizes
|
||||||
'lazysizes': {
|
'lazysizes': {
|
||||||
'path': 'resources/lazysizes/{version}/lazysizes.min.jsm',
|
'path': 'resources/lazysizes/{version}/lazysizes.min.jsm',
|
||||||
|
@ -236,6 +236,8 @@ helpers.determineResourceName = function (filename) {
|
|||||||
return 'jQuery jeditable';
|
return 'jQuery jeditable';
|
||||||
case 'jquery.jeditable.min.jsm':
|
case 'jquery.jeditable.min.jsm':
|
||||||
return 'jQuery Validation Plugin';
|
return 'jQuery Validation Plugin';
|
||||||
|
case 'js.cookie.min.jsm':
|
||||||
|
return 'JavaScript Cookie';
|
||||||
case 'lazysizes.min.jsm':
|
case 'lazysizes.min.jsm':
|
||||||
return 'lazysizes';
|
return 'lazysizes';
|
||||||
case 'lozad.min.jsm':
|
case 'lozad.min.jsm':
|
||||||
@ -374,6 +376,8 @@ helpers.setLastVersion = function (type, version) {
|
|||||||
version = '1.19.1';
|
version = '1.19.1';
|
||||||
} else if (type.includes('/jquery-jeditable/1.')) {
|
} else if (type.includes('/jquery-jeditable/1.')) {
|
||||||
version = '1.8.0';
|
version = '1.8.0';
|
||||||
|
} else if (type.includes('/js-cookie/2.')) {
|
||||||
|
version = '2.2.1';
|
||||||
} else if (type.includes('/lazysizes/4.')) {
|
} else if (type.includes('/lazysizes/4.')) {
|
||||||
version = '4.1.8';
|
version = '4.1.8';
|
||||||
} else if (type.includes('lozad')) {
|
} else if (type.includes('lozad')) {
|
||||||
|
@ -34,6 +34,7 @@
|
|||||||
<li>Added jQuery jeditable v1.8.0</li>
|
<li>Added jQuery jeditable v1.8.0</li>
|
||||||
<li>Added D3.js v3.5.17</li>
|
<li>Added D3.js v3.5.17</li>
|
||||||
<li>Added P2P Media Loader Core v0.6.2</li>
|
<li>Added P2P Media Loader Core v0.6.2</li>
|
||||||
|
<li>Added JavaScript Cookie v2.2.1</li>
|
||||||
</ul>
|
</ul>
|
||||||
<div class="topic-label">
|
<div class="topic-label">
|
||||||
Please update your uBlock/uMatrix rules
|
Please update your uBlock/uMatrix rules
|
||||||
|
1
resources/js-cookie/2.2.1/js.cookie.min.jsm
Normal file
1
resources/js-cookie/2.2.1/js.cookie.min.jsm
Normal file
@ -0,0 +1 @@
|
|||||||
|
!function(e){var n;if("function"==typeof define&&define.amd&&(define(e),n=!0),"object"==typeof exports&&(module.exports=e(),n=!0),!n){var t=window.Cookies,o=window.Cookies=e();o.noConflict=function(){return window.Cookies=t,o}}}(function(){function f(){for(var e=0,n={};e<arguments.length;e++){var t=arguments[e];for(var o in t)n[o]=t[o]}return n}function a(e){return e.replace(/(%[0-9A-Z]{2})+/g,decodeURIComponent)}return function e(u){function c(){}function t(e,n,t){if("undefined"!=typeof document){"number"==typeof(t=f({path:"/"},c.defaults,t)).expires&&(t.expires=new Date(1*new Date+864e5*t.expires)),t.expires=t.expires?t.expires.toUTCString():"";try{var o=JSON.stringify(n);/^[\{\[]/.test(o)&&(n=o)}catch(e){}n=u.write?u.write(n,e):encodeURIComponent(String(n)).replace(/%(23|24|26|2B|3A|3C|3E|3D|2F|3F|40|5B|5D|5E|60|7B|7D|7C)/g,decodeURIComponent),e=encodeURIComponent(String(e)).replace(/%(23|24|26|2B|5E|60|7C)/g,decodeURIComponent).replace(/[\(\)]/g,escape);var r="";for(var i in t)t[i]&&(r+="; "+i,!0!==t[i]&&(r+="="+t[i].split(";")[0]));return document.cookie=e+"="+n+r}}function n(e,n){if("undefined"!=typeof document){for(var t={},o=document.cookie?document.cookie.split("; "):[],r=0;r<o.length;r++){var i=o[r].split("="),c=i.slice(1).join("=");n||'"'!==c.charAt(0)||(c=c.slice(1,-1));try{var f=a(i[0]);if(c=(u.read||u)(c,f)||a(c),n)try{c=JSON.parse(c)}catch(e){}if(t[f]=c,e===f)break}catch(e){}}return e?t[e]:t}}return c.set=t,c.get=function(e){return n(e,!1)},c.getJSON=function(e){return n(e,!0)},c.remove=function(e,n){t(e,"",f(n,{expires:-1}))},c.defaults={},c.withConverter=e,c}(function(){})});
|
Reference in New Issue
Block a user